ABB PP836A (Panel 800 Series)
Description
Product Introduction
PP836A is a rugged, compact operator panel that combines a color TFT display, resistive touchscreen, and physical keys. The A variant offers extended temperature range and enhanced environmental protection compared to the standard PP836, making it suitable for harsh conditions like cold storage, outdoor facilities, and heavy industry. It serves as the primary interface for process visualization, control, alarm management, and recipe handling.
Model Interpretation
PP: Panel / Operator Interface
836: 7-inch model in Panel 800 series
A: Extended temperature & enhanced ruggedization variant
3BSE042237R2: ABB part number (hardware revision)
Technical Parameters
Display: 7-inch TFT LCD, 800 × 480 pixels, LED backlight
Operation: Resistive touchscreen + 22 physical keys (gloved-hand friendly)
Processor: ARM9 core, 1 GHz
Memory: 512 MB RAM, 2 GB SSD
Power Supply: 24 V DC (19.2–30 V DC), 1.5 A typical
Operating Temperature: ‑20°C to +60°C (extended range)
Protection Class: Front IP66, rear IP20
Dimensions (W×H×D): 220 × 160 × 40 mm
Weight: 1.88 kg
Certifications: CE, UL, CSA; IEC 61131‑3 compliant
Interface and Communication Configuration
Ethernet: 2 × 10/100 Mbps RJ45 (Modbus TCP, OPC UA, PROFINET)
Serial: 1 × RS‑485 (Modbus RTU)
USB: 2 × USB 2.0 (host/client, data transfer, firmware update)
Backplane: Panel 800 internal bus (I/O expansion)
Isolation: 2500 V AC isolation for serial/field circuits
Core Functions
Real‑time process visualization: trends, bar graphs, schematics
Operator control: setpoint adjustment, device start/stop, mode selection
Alarm management: display, acknowledge, log, and filter events
Recipe handling: store, recall, and modify production recipes
Data logging: historical trending and data export via USB
Multi‑language support: 20+ languages with font customization
Self‑diagnostics: LED status (PWR, RUN, ALARM) and fault logging

Operation and Maintenance Instructions
Panel‑mount in 1.5–9 mm thick panels; use provided gaskets for IP66 seal
Use shielded cables for Ethernet/serial; separate power and signal wiring
Configure via Panel Builder 800 software; download projects via Ethernet/USB
Clean front panel with mild detergent; avoid harsh chemicals
Check LED indicators and cable connections during routine maintenance
No user‑serviceable parts; replace unit on permanent failure
Store in dry, clean environment (‑40°C to +85°C, 5–95% RH non‑condensing)
